Understanding Tesla Ultrasonic Sensor Functionality

The Tesla Ultrasonic Sensor, strategically incorporated into the vehicle’s exterior, plays a pivotal role in enhancing safety and facilitating advanced driver assistance systems (ADAS). These sensors act as the eyes and ears of the car, detecting obstacles and providing crucial data for features like automatic emergency braking, lane-keeping assist, and parallel parking assistance. By emitting high-frequency sound waves, the sensors create a detailed 3D map of surroundings, enabling the vehicle to navigate with precision.

When a minor collision or impact occurs, particularly during parking maneuvers, the protective ultrasonic sensor cover may sustain damage. While it safeguards the intricate sensor mechanism from direct impact, a crack or dent could compromise its effectiveness. Prompt recognition and replacement of this component are essential to maintain optimal sensor performance and ensure the continued provision of safety features. Step-by-Step Guide to Replacement Cover Installation

Replacing a Tesla ultrasonic sensor cover after a parking collision is a straightforward process that can be accomplished with the right tools and guidance. First, gather all necessary parts, including a new sensor cover designed specifically for your Tesla model. Ensure compatibility to avoid any issues during installation. Next, locate the damaged cover by inspecting the vehicle around the ultrasonic sensors, typically found at the front and rear bumpers. Using a screwdriver, carefully remove any screws securing the old cover in place.

Once the cover is removed, clean the surrounding area to ensure there’s no debris or dirt that could interfere with sensor functionality. After cleaning, align the new cover carefully over the sensors, making sure it fits perfectly. Secure it with screws, ensuring they are tightly fastened. Test the sensors by driving the vehicle at low speeds to confirm their operation and effectiveness in detecting obstacles.
